What is a panel indicator light?

Panel indicator lights, also known as pilot lights or signal lamps, are small lights used to provide visual indications for various equipment or systems. These lights play a crucial role in conveying important information to users or operators. They are commonly found on control panels, appliances, machinery, and electronic devices. Panel indicator lights use different colors, shapes, and patterns to represent different states or conditions.

Functions and Types of Panel Indicator Lights

Panel indicator lights serve various functions, and their type and design vary based on the intended purpose. Some common functions of panel indicator lights include:

1. Power Indication: Panel indicator lights often indicate whether the equipment or system is powered on or off. A steady or blinking light can represent different power states.

 

2. Status Indication: These lights can indicate the status of the system, such as standby mode, operational mode, fault or error conditions, or completion of a specific task.

 

3. Function Indication: Indicator lights can be used to indicate the functioning of particular features or components within the system. For example, in an automobile, panel indicator lights can indicate the status of headlights, fog lights, or turn signals.

 

4. Warning Indication: Panel indicator lights serve as warning signals, alerting operators or users about any potential hazards, failures, or abnormal conditions.

 

Based on their intended usage, panel indicator lights come in various types, including:

1. LED Indicator Lights: Light Emitting Diode (LED) lights are highly energy-efficient and have a long lifespan. They provide bright and vibrant colors, making them suitable for use in various applications.

 

2. Incandescent Indicator Lights: Incandescent lights use a filament that emits light when heated by an electric current. These lights are less energy-efficient than LEDs but are still commonly used due to their low cost.

 

3. Neon Indicator Lights: Neon indicator lights contain neon gas, which emits a vibrant glow when current passes through it. These lights are commonly used in older equipment or systems.

 

4. Bulb Indicator Lights: Bulb indicator lights use small bulbs to emit light. They are less commonly used compared to LEDs or incandescent lights due to their lower efficiency and shorter lifespan.

 

5. Multicolor Indicator Lights: Some panel indicator lights can change colors or have multiple colors within a single light, allowing for more versatile visual indications.

 

Factors to Consider for Panel Indicator Lights Selection

When selecting panel indicator lights, several factors should be considered to ensure they meet the desired requirements. These factors include:

1. Visibility: The light should be bright enough and have suitable contrast to ensure clear visibility, even in bright or dimly lit environments.

 

2. Colors: Different colors represent different meanings, so choosing the appropriate color is important for conveying the desired information effectively.

 

3. Durability: The lights should be able to withstand the environmental conditions they will be exposed to, such as high temperatures, moisture, or vibrations.

 

4. Energy Efficiency: Energy-efficient lights, such as LEDs, are preferred to minimize power consumption and reduce operational costs.

 

5. Mounting Options: Panel indicator lights must have suitable mounting options to be easily installed on the equipment or control panels.

 

6. Longevity: The lights should have a long lifespan to minimize replacement and maintenance needs.

 

7. Compatibility: The electrical specifications of the lights should match the available power sources and control systems.

 

Applications of Panel Indicator Lights

Panel indicator lights find applications in various industries, including:

1. Industrial Sector: They are extensively used in control panels of machinery and equipment, indicating the status, power, and functioning of different components. They play a critical role in monitoring and ensuring the efficient operation of industrial processes.

 

2. Automotive Industry: Panel indicator lights are an integral part of automotive dashboards. They indicate the status of various systems like engine, transmission, battery, oil pressure, and more. They provide essential information to drivers for safe and effective vehicle operation.

3. Electronics and Appliances: Indicator lights are present on electronic devices, appliances, and consumer products. They indicate power status, charging mode, operational modes, and any error conditions to users. For example, on a laptop, the power button and caps lock key often have indicator lights.

4. Aviation and Aerospace: Panel indicator lights are crucial in aircraft and spacecraft control panels. They provide critical information to pilots or astronauts regarding system status, warnings, navigation, and communication.

5. Healthcare Sector: Indicator lights are used in medical equipment to indicate power on/off, status, alarms, or error conditions. They provide essential visual cues to healthcare professionals, ensuring patient safety and efficient equipment operation.
